Well, the heat is on here for the summer! Fortunately, I’m used to it now and a 100-degree day is just another day to me. Even though I say that, I don’t take such temperatures lightly. It is so easy to get dehydrated and that can be very dangerous.

I remember back in 2012 I decided to go for a run on one of my favorite trails. It was a lot tougher than I thought. I didn’t have a set distance in mind, but once I started running, I decided that I would run 8 miles that day.

As it turns out, that wasn’t the smartest decision, as I hadn’t been on an 8 mile run in over 10 years. I’ll fill you in on all the details when we chat face to face, but let’s just say that the results were less than spectacular. In the end, I only ran 4.5 miles and then slowly walked 4.5 miles back to the car.

My run was pretty miserable because I hadn’t properly prepared myself and certainly wasn’t properly hydrated. As it turns out, the high temperature during my run that day was 108 degrees, one of the top ten hottest days on record for the area!
